Abstract. Problem. The operation of transport systems of a large city must ensure a continuous flow of passengers. The subway occupies a special place in the city's transport system. The constant increase in the loading of the subway not only worsens the conditions of passenger transportation, but also shortens the service life of the rolling stock and negatively affects the reliability of its operation. In the future, this may cause failures of the rolling stock, which means work failures. The main factor in the development of subway systems is passenger traffic, which determines the development of the subway network, the capacity of technical equipment, the number of vehicles, the size of depots and vehicle repair plants, and the time of repair with the least economic losses. Thus, one of the urgent tasks of the functioning of transport systems is the creation of an automated system of mass passenger service, in particular in the subway. Goal. The tasks of this study are the analysis of the subject area, the design of the information system according to the task, the selection of the necessary tools for this development, and the methods of software implementation. Analysis of passenger flows using an automated system will allow to solve many problems of design, operation, and planning of metro work, will allow to reduce the time for passenger service and optimize passenger flows. Methodology. Research methods are the methods of mass service systems. Results. The creation of a functional model will make it possible to develop a software product for the analysis and assessment of public transport passenger traffic. Originality. Practical value. The software product created on the basis of the developed functional model will enable the user not only to analyze, but also to optimize the work of both existing and future metro stations.
